What does the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A) point out regarding red snapper size?

Answer

Many species labeled as red snapper are excellent eating fish across most size ranges.

Fisheries experts, specifically the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A), provide a counterpoint to the belief that large snapper are inherently poor quality. NOAA observes that many species categorized as red snapper, particularly the esteemed American variety, are generally considered excellent eating regardless of their size range. The agency implies that perceived quality issues in larger fish might be situational—perhaps resulting from localized diet, habitat differences, or stress/improper handling after the catch—rather than being an unavoidable consequence of the fish simply surpassing a certain weight threshold.
